To find the area of a rectangle, you need to multiply the length by the width.
In this case, the length is five-twelfths units and the width is four-fifths units.
Multiplying these two fractions gives us:
(5/12) * (4/5) = (20/60) = 1/3
Therefore, the area of the rectangle is 1/3 square units.
